Anthony Greene vs. Rip Byson strap match set for Limitless High Strung

A grudge that has been building since September will reach new heights at Limitless Wrestling’s High Strung on December 31st in Worcester, MA, as Anthony Greene will fight Rip Byson in a strap match.

After picking up a win over Ryan Mooney at this month’s Dirty Laundry, Byson issued the challenge to Greene who later accepted as he was not at the event — something Byson called him out on.

It began when the two-time Limitless Wrestling World Champion picked up a win over Byson at September’s Chasing Forever by ripping off Byson’s boot and then using Byson’s weightlifting belt as leverage on a roll-up pin. It continued at October’s Fresh Blood 3 when Byson prevented Greene from using part of a turnbuckle on Big Beef, leading to Beef picking up the win. Later that night, Greene attacked Byson from behind following Byson’s win over Covey Christ and MORTAR, attacking him with Byson’s weightlifting belt.
